When your elder relative can no longer make decisions for themselves, a legal guardianship is necessary. A legal guardian allows another person to make decisions with regard to finances, health, and living arrangements on behalf of another person. At the Law Offices of Debra G. When a loved one dies with or without a will, the administration of their estate is necessary to pass legal title of their assets. When someone dies, ownership of all assets in that person’s name now pass to someone else. The Probate process provides the rules and oversight of that process.
